Built upon the WebAuthn standard, Passkeys utilize public and private key cryptography. The public key is saved on the server, and the private key is saved on your device. While a passkey cannot get physically lost, the device that the private key is saved could be. In this situation the passkey can be restored through iCloud Keychain or Google Password Manager.


If a device with a passkey is lost, someone else will not be able to access your passkey without your PIN/Passcode/Biometrics.
